How much does it cost to rent a home in Riverside Community?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Riverside Community 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,751 | $1,650 | $6,990 |
| Riverside Community 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,991 | $2,100 | $10,000+ |
| Riverside Community 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$7,295 | $3,200 | $10,000+ |
| Riverside Community 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$8,594 | $4,277 | $10,000+ |
| Riverside Community 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$9,000 | $7,500 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Riverside Community
What type of rentals are currently available in Riverside Community?
There are currently 1776 Apartments for Rent in Riverside Community,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,082 to $15,000. There are also 184 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Riverside Community ranging from $1,350 to $27,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Riverside Community?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Riverside Community ranges from $1,350 to $27,500 with an average monthly rent of $7,998.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Riverside Community?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Riverside Community range from $2,050 to $11,517,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,100 to $14,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,200 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$3,195.
